Best Practices for Storing Kayaks in a Garage

When it comes to storing kayaks in a garage, there are several effective methods to consider. Each option has its own advantages, depending on your garage layout and the number of kayaks you own. Here’s a breakdown of the best practices for storing kayaks safely and efficiently.

Wall-Mounted Racks

Wall-mounted racks are an excellent choice for those looking to save floor space. These racks allow you to keep your kayak off the ground, reducing the risk of damage. Ensure you select a sturdy rack that can support the weight of your kayak and has padded arms to prevent scratches. For more, see our complete guide on Store Kayaks.

Ceiling Hoists

If your garage has a high ceiling, a ceiling hoist can be a fantastic solution. This method allows you to lift your kayak vertically, freeing up valuable floor space. Make sure to check that your ceiling can support the weight of the kayak and follow the installation instructions carefully.

Freestanding Racks

Freestanding racks offer flexibility and are ideal if you prefer not to mount anything on your walls. These racks can be moved around as needed and can accommodate multiple kayaks. Essential Equipment for Kayak Storage

When setting up your kayak storage system, consider investing in the following accessories: You may also find our Kayaks helpful.

  • Kayak Storage Racks: Choose between wall-mounted, ceiling, or freestanding options based on your needs.
  • Straps and Tie-Downs: Use these to secure your kayak in place, especially if using a hoist.
  • Protective Covers: These can help shield your kayak from dust and potential damage.
